Does it really last forever?
Well, nothing actually lasts for ever… but Makeup Forever Aqua Liner ($23) does not smudge, or rub off. I’ve been wearing it for a week, and have never had to reapply half way through the day. I’ve yet to experience smudging, flaking, sliding or anything like that with this. The downside to this is that you really have to use a good eye makeup remover to get it off, because normal cleanser will still require a bit of scrubbing.

I have oily eyelids and Asian eyes that don’t have much of a crease, which means liquid liner usually lasts about an hour before it starts migrating. Recently I started using Geisha Ink and it’s amazing! The formula truly is rubproof and smudgeproof and lasts all day. It won’t hold up against tears, but it does last for everyday wear and through a sweaty night of salsa dancing. The brush tip is superfine so it’s easy to draw a superthin or a thick yet precise line.
